Transaction 53a710b0281c49b942854e255890d8105c006714d6ee50f42b3a2dc175c28520
1 Input
1 Output
-
53a710b0281c49b942854e255890d8105c006714d6ee50f42b3a2dc175c28520:0
- value
- 638572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56c4e5d4e0defc81a66475cea3d631c2561d2884 OP_EQUAL
- address
- 39boujoLdzny7z7kPnrxjhyJYS8GUQCf6B